摘要
采用有限元分析法对管道漏磁法检测的漏磁场理论进行了研究,通过有限元分析可以对各种情况下管道壁缺陷的漏磁情况进行仿真,弥补了磁偶极子模型解析法的局限性。还介绍了有限元分析软件ANSYS分析管道漏磁场的过程,并通过ANSYS分析研究了提离值对漏磁信号的影响,并进行了漏磁检测器磁化装置的优化设计。
Magnetic leakage field theory in magnetic flux leakage(MFL) testing of pipeline using finite element method was researched, by which MFL conditions of pipeline defect could be imitated through fair and foul, and compensate for the limitation of magnetic dipole method. The analyzing process of magnetic leakage field using finite element analyzing software ANSYS was introduced. The effect of lift-off on MFL signal was analyzed by ANSYS and the design of the magnetizing system of MFL detector was optimized.
